Maximizing Your Radiologist Earnings in Davis

Specializations such as interventional radiology and neuroradiology are particularly lucrative in Davis, as these areas often command premium pay compared to general practices. Compensation levels can vary greatly depending on the type of employer, with private radiology group practices typically offering compensation structures that include partnership benefits, while hospital-employed positions may provide stability but lower pay. Teleradiology opportunities also exist, particularly for those willing to take on night and weekend shifts, often leading to additional side income. Aspiring to leadership positions such as a radiology group practice partner or a department chair can further enhance earning potential. Advanced credentials, including board certification from the ABR and completion of subspecialty fellowships, not only improve salary prospects but also provide avenues for career advancement in a competitive field. Non-salary compensation factors like RVU productivity, partnership equity stakes, and specialty mix further influence the overall financial package for senior radiologists in this vibrant CA community.
